**POSITION OVERVIEW**:
The **Regional **Used Vehicle Development Manager **will be responsible for the planning, organization, and management of activities related to the used inventory for multiple dealership locations operating across Canada.
**JOB RESPONSIBILITIES**:
- Support your assigned Platform Vice Presidents in Used Vehicle Operational Excellence
- Lead yourself and the Used Car Sales teams you support in a manner that is reflective of AutoCanada’s mission and core values
- Manage the AutoCanada Aging Vehicle Policy by creating functional work plans to regularly move inventory between dealerships operating in your assigned area to ensure each store has an effective inventory mix that is priced to market
- Obtain and exceed projections for used vehicle sales volume and PVR with a keen eye for addressing inventory gaps through cost effective vehicle acquisition channels and relationships
- Provide mentorship to AutoCanada’s Used Car Managers and emerging Sales talent with detailed training about the value of thorough vehicle appraisals, customer involvement in the appraisal process, reconditioning requirements, etc.
- Drives effective merchandising of used vehicle inventory in the assigned area, to include all AutoCanada point-of-purchase materials being used to drive customer interest and gross profit
- Provide a high-level of involvement in the day-to-day sales, appraisal, and wholesale operations for dealerships you have a responsibility to monitor and develop
- Partnering with dealership General Managers in the effort to develop their Recon Department repair approval processes that encourage Variable and Fixed Operations to work cross-functionally to effectively manage vehicle reconditioning costs, repair times, and overall store profitability
- Forecast market used car sales and profitability results by dealership providing updates to Platform and Corporate leadership on a weekly basis
- Engage and motivate dealership teams to achieve departmental goals, OEM CPO expectations, and deliver excellence through the adoption of AutoCanada processes and procedures
- Managing controllable expense elements for the market Used Vehicle Departments
- Organization of regional auction activities, independent wholesale vehicle providers, etc.
- Analyzing the business to determine shortfalls and developing action plans to improve performance, which will include working with 3rd party vendors to maximize company ROI on U/C advertisement and lead providers
- Demonstrates behaviors consistent with the Company’s core values in all interactions with customers, co-workers, and vendors
- Adheres to all company policies, procedures, and safety standards
